I'm going to go back and say again that I'm not asking that we add new pieces to the Criminal Code that will create criminal offences that are not already there. These are criminal offences that are already there.
I would like to read to you subsection 372(1) of the code, which says:
Every one who, with intent to injure or alarm any person, conveys or causes or procures to be conveyed by letter, telegram, telephone, cable, radio or otherwise information that he knows is false is guilty of an indictable offence and liable to imprisonment for a term not exceeding two years.
We're not just talking about simple cyberbullying. There is a place when cyberbullying crosses to become “false messages”, which is the section I'm reading from. The point is that if it's been clearly stated what are the modes of communication....
It says “or otherwise”, and some people are interpreting it to not mean computers, while others may say, yes, it does mean computers. The point is that it's not clear, and my bill is to clarify those criminal elements.
